I like this premium ear buds and since I bought this in 2014 this is essential for trans-Pacific travels, which QC20 had made comfortable with great cancelling of white noise during the flights and long battery life. BUT, the cable connection to both sides of the unit is too fragile. I am keeping it working by putting tapes after starting to have this issue 1.5 yrs later, but this is really ugly for a piece costing a few hundred bucks. Also the rubber cover for the unit is also torn, which is ok without affecting function. But this cable issue is really annoying and make it a piece of junk if I put take not at a right angle. This must improved with a newer version and hopefully Bose offers replacing this poorly functioning unit with a new one.

I've had my QC in-ear headphones for about three years now and I use them several times a week during my public transit commute, and four or five times a month while on an airplane. I used to have the over-the-ear noise canceling headphones, but besides being big and bulky, they also made my ears hurt on long flights. Not so with these little buds. The noise cancelling and the sound quality is PHENOMENAL! Even on that flight when surrounded with three crying infants, the noise was blocked out and I was completely zen. After heavy usage over the last three years, I'm starting to hear a bit of crackling and it's about time to replace them with another pair of QC headphones. I highly recommend these earphones for people who fly a lot or who commute by public transit -- they make the world a better place!
